Kitchen grout repl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or stained grout from between tiles and installing fresh, durable grout in its place. This process typically includes carefully removing the existing grout without damaging the surrounding tiles, thoroughly cleaning the joints, and applying new grout that matches the style and color of the original or desired look. Skilled service providers ensure that the new grout is properly sealed and finished, helping to restore the appearance of kitchen surfaces and improve their overall functionality.
This service helps address common problems such as cracked, crumbling, or discolored grout that can compromise the integrity of tiled surfaces. Over time, grout can absorb stains, develop mold or mildew, and become difficult to clean, which not only affects the visual appeal but can also lead to water seepage behind tiles. Replacing the grout can prevent further damage, eliminate unsightly stains, and create a cleaner, more hygienic environment in kitchens. The overview below groups typical Kitchen Grout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Katy,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or grout repairs or spot fixes in kitchens usually range from $150 to $400.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and size of the area. Fewer projects require larger or more complex repairs that can exceed $600.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of grout in a standard kitchen can cost between $250 and $600.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ently, with most falling into this moderate price band. Larger, more extensive partial replacements may approach $1,000 or more.
Full Grout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of all grout in a kitchen typically costs from $1,000 to $3,000. Many projects stay within this range, but larger kitchens or complex tile layouts can push costs higher, into the $4,000+ range.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ive grout work, such as in large kitchens or with specialty materials, can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ve detailed or customized work that increases labor and material costs significantly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that kitchen grout needs to be replaced? Indicators include visible cracks, discoloration, mold growth, or crumbling grout that affects the appearance and functionality of your kitchen surfaces.
Can replacing kitchen grout help improve the kitchen’s overall look? Yes, fresh grout can enhance the appearance of tile work, making the kitchen look cleaner and more updated.
Are there different types of grout suitable for kitchen areas? Yes, various grout types are available, such as epoxy or sanded and unsanded cement-based options, each suited for specific tile and usage conditions.
